The cat of the house has its nap interrupted by two playing puppies, which sets off a chain of events.
On Christmas morning two pups and the household's children are up early. The pups are frightened by a large stuffed dog, a train set, a crying doll, a toy tank, and other toys.

This film is very reminiscent of "Cabin in the Sky", in that you have a very sexy Ethel Waters about to be married to Stepin Fetchit. Fetchit's friends Louis Armstrong and Fats Waller are trying to get him to the church on time, but Stepin isn't in any hurry to get hitched.
Bosko is on his way to give a bag of cookies to Grandma when he gets stopped by a frog that sounds like Louis Armstrong. He and other frog caricatures of famous African-American musicians like Fats Waller, Cab Calloway, and Bill "Bojangles" Robinson are portrayed as cannibals.
